The aim of the project is to make improvements to the road and install additional safety measures to reduce the number of crashes occurring in this section of Stakehill Road. In developing the design for this project, we have taken into consideration public safety, existing public and private infrastructure and the Austroads and Main Roads WA (MRWA) guidelines.
The following upgrades are proposed:
- removal and undergrounding of the Western Power power poles and overhead cables
- reconstruction of the road curves
- construction of a two-metre-wide sealed shoulder with edge lines
- installation of street lighting, and
- installation of a crash barrier.
The works commenced on 15 April 2024 with an anticipated completion of 30 June 2024. Please refer to the image below for the project location.

Traffic Management Related Information
During construction, traffic management will be in effect as per the approved Traffic Management Plan. This will include partial road closures and detours during certain stages however, the intersections will remain open for the duration of the works. The table below depicts the partial, directional closures and the planned traffic management stages. The dates highlighted are the scheduled dates however these may change depending on site and other unforeseen circumstances.
